Remember Pearl Harbor

Visit USS Arizona Memorial, USS Missouri

The Dec. 7, 1941, Japanese attack on the U.S. Pacific fleet anchored at Pearl Harbor was a devastating blow to American military might. In about two hours, 21 ships were either sunk or damaged beyong repair, 188 aircraft were destroyed and 2,403 Americans were killed.

A special floating memorial now sits above the wreck of the USS Arizona, one of eight battleships destroyed that day. It's the only part of the military base, near Honolulu, open to the public, and visiting it makes for a sobering experience. The ship, which serves as a tomb for more than 1,100 of its crewmembers killed in the attack, is still visible. The National Park Service operates the memorial. Free tours run from 7:30 a.m. to 3 p.m. every day.

One of the battleships that survived Pearl Harbor is now a floating museum. The USS Missouri, aboard which the Japanese surrendered on in Tokyo Harbor, and which later took part in the first Gulf war, is now moored alongside the Arizona memorial. Guided tours, hosted by Navy veterans, take visitors to the actual surrender site as well as sweeping views of the harbor from the Missouri's bridge. Tours run daily from 9 a.m. to 5 p.m. Admisssion costs $16 for adults and $8 for children. For more information visit the Missouri's Web site.
